jka Posted March 19, 2018 Share Posted March 19, 2018 The AIM method stopped working since this past weekend. When we contacted Authorize.net they say its probably related to disabling TLS 1.0 and 1.1. We had this issues with UPS module and have the latest cURL ... curl --version curl 7.57.0 (x86_64-redhat-linux-gnu) libcurl/7.57.0 NSS/3.28.4 zlib/1.2.7 libpsl/0.7.0 (+libicu/50.1.2) libssh2/1.8.0 nghttp2/1.21.1 Release-Date: 2017-11-29 In the transaction logs its a cURL timeout cURL Error (28): Connection timed out after 15000 milliseconds The UPS module started working fine once we updated cURL and we have also disable TLS1.0 and 1.1 Any hardcoding on the Authorize.net module??
